Director of Rehabilitation (DOR)

Jacksonville, FL

Responsibilities

Position Summary

The Director of Rehabilitation (DOR) is a member of the Rehabilitation Leadership Council, and participates in the establishment of policies and procedures for all IP therapy services. Designs and implements a framework to integrate and coordinate patient care services, and program development with all IP therapy departments within the assigned facility, consistent with quality service and maximization of profit. Provides direction, expertise and mentoring to facilitate the growth and development of IP rehabilitation therapy services. Directs daily operations of inpatient physical, occupational and speech therapy services.

Specific Duties

    Ensures the design of patient care services provided within the therapy departments is appropriate to the scope and level of care for the patients served.
  • Recruits, selects, directs and supports the activities of the Clinical Managers in the therapy departments within the assigned facility.
  • Develops programs to promote the recruitment, retention, and continuing education of all staff members in conjunction with the Clinical Managers, Directors of Rehab Therapy Services across the Division, HR and the Director of Education.
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ications

  • Current state licensure as a Physical, Occupational or Speech Therapist required. (For Speech discipline: Current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) in Speech Language Pathology from the American Speech-Language & Hearing Association required.)
  • A minimum of seven (7) years of experience as a therapist in an acute rehab setting, including a minimum of five years supervisory experience required.

Select Medical's Inpatient Rehabilitation Hospitals provide advanced treatment and comprehensive care to best address the medical, physical, emotional and vocational challenges for individuals with:

  • Brain Injury
  • Spinal Cord Injury
  • Stroke
  • Amputation
  • Neurological Disorders
  • Orthopedic Conditions
  • Multiple Traumas
